COMMON NAME(S): LEAF: opposite, 4-7" long and wide, palmately 5-lobed; edges with scattered long teeth5 to 7 veins from notched base BARK: gray or brown; becoming rough and furrowed into narrow ridges FRUIT: 1 1/2 - 2" long; paired keys spreading widely, light brown, hanging on long stalk GROWTH: 60 feet DISTRIBUTION: Native across Europe from Norway to Caucasus; widely planted in the United States LOCATION: South Park, Quincy, IL |
